Web15 feb. 2024 · Normally, most metal parts under 15 grams are produced by metal injection molding, as MIM technology allow thinner structures with high efficiency of materials and energy. Meanwhile, 90% metal parts above 100 grams are manufactured by investment casting, since the cost of MIM metal powders is too high. WebHandbook of Metal Injection Molding - Donald F. Heaney 2024-05-21 Metal injection molding combines the most useful characteristics of powder metallurgy and plastic injection molding to facilitate the production of small, complex-shaped metal components with outstanding mechanical properties.

WebCompared to metal sintering, the MIM process is also capable of: Offering a superior magnetic performance. Producing one part where metal sintering processes would have produced two components in need of assembly.
